Notes:
This disc is expected to play back in DVD video "play only" devices, and may not play back in other DVD devices, including recorders and PC drives"--Container.
Based on the novel by Gordon Parks.
Originally produced as motion picture in 1969.
Kyle Johnson, Alex Clarke, Estelle Evans, Dana Elcar, Mira Waters, Joel Fluellen, Malcolm Atterbury, Richard Ward, Russell Thorson, Peggy Rea.
MPAA rating: PG.
DVD; NTSC; all region (region 0); widescreen 16x9, 2.4:1; Dolby Digital mono.
Named to the National Film Registry in 1989 by the Library of Congress.
Summary:
Set in 1920s Kansas, the film traces one year in the life of young Newt, in which he learns about love, fear, racial injustice, and his own capacity for honor.
